Sports Desk: Bangladesh Cricket Board (BCB) has allowed left-arm cutter Mostafizur Rahman to play in the IPL. BCB CEO Nizamuddin Chowdhury Sujon confirmed the matter to the media.

When Shakib Al Hasan was allowed to play in the IPL, Akram Khan, chairman of the BCB's cricket operations committee, said that if Mostafizur Rahman also asked for permission, he would be allowed. Permission has been obtained from the BCB.

So, there is no obstacle in front of Mostafiz to play in India's multi-billion dollar tournament IPL. Rajasthan Royals have bought Mostafiz from this year's IPL auction. A few days ago, Shakib Al Hasan took leave from the BCB to play in the IPL for KKR.

At the same time, Bangladesh will play a Test series against Sri Lanka. Shakib will play in the IPL excluding that series. There is a lot of criticism about that in Bangladesh. In such a situation, there were doubts whether Mostafiz would play in the IPL or not. Although Mostafiz had informed them earlier, the country is bigger than IPL for him.

However, on Saturday, the BCB chief executive said, "Mostafiz has also been given a clearance." "Mostafiz is not planned for the Test against Sri Lanka," he said. That is why we have given him a no-objection letter for the IPL.

Playing there (in India) will be good for him, he will have some more experience. ' This means that Mostafiz will be in the team for the two-Test series to be held in Sri Lanka. He will play in the IPL for Rajasthan Royals for Rs 1 crore. Another IPL star in Bangladesh Shakib Al Hasan left for Kolkata on Saturday to join KKR.
